Situated in Bahia, Brazil, Amélia Rodrigues is a town. Its coordinates of -12.402°, -38.752° place it in the tropical zone of the southern hemisphere. Population sits at roughly 24,138 according to the open data we track. Its latitude implies a climate characterised by warm temperatures throughout the year with pronounced wet and dry seasons. Solar-resource estimates put the area at about 1,920 kWh/m² of solar irradiance per year with sunshine for roughly 75% of daylight hours.
